内容記述 | This study examines two lecture-based lessons at a national university through lesson analysis to understand students’ cognition and affect in lecture-based lessons. Emphasis is here placed on the relationship between students’ expressive behavior and both their cognition and affect. Evidence-based data analysis including a questionnaire and video analysis was applied for data collection and analysis. This study finds that 1) students who look at the lecturer for a long time tend to understand the lesson,especially in a relatively ineffective lesson. Students who spontaneously take a lot of notes tend to be highly interested in the lesson,but do not necessarily understand the lesson. Students who look sleepy cannot understand the lesson effectively, but it doesn’t mean that they are not interested. 2)In a relatively ineffective lesson, when students get interested,they tend to look at the lecturer more than usual. However, in a relatively effective lesson,when students get interested,they are motivated to smile or take notes spontaneously more than usual,and sometimes the amount of nodding also increases. 3)In a relatively ineffective lesson,the lecturer occasionally makes a digression which is unimportant but funny, and it makes students interested. However, in a relatively effective lesson, the lecturer uses several teaching methods, such as posing questions which students try to answer,and the lecturer tries to make the whole lesson intellectual and interesting from the eyes of students. | |||||
